Abstract :
ABSTRACT: In order to investigation of genetic variation among lentil lines and genetic relationship these to Cistan local cultivar, DNA of 20 lentil lines and Cistan local cultivar were analysed using random amplified polymorphic DNA (RAPD) and intron-exon splice junctions (ISJ) markers. PIC, MI, percentage of polymorphic bands (P), Nei , s gene diversity (H), Shannon, s information index (I) were calculated for both random, semi random and combined of random and semi random primers. For both matrices, genetic similarity (GSRAPD and GSISJ) were calculated according to the Jaccard similarity coefficient. Correlation between two similarity matrices obtained with two markers types was estimated. The similarity matrix per marker was subjected to cluster analysis by the unweighted pair-group method (UPGMA). The of RAPD was as as ISJ, but MI index of ISJ (average 6.095) was much higher than RAPD (average 4.49). Mean of genetic similarity of RAPD marker was higher than ISJ marker, and combined of RAPD and ISJ markers. Thus in order to estimate of genetic diversity in lentil lines, ISJ marker was better than RAPD marker and combined of RAPD and ISJ markers was also better than RAPD marker. For RAPDs the similarity values ranged from 0.166 between TN2026 line and TN2464 line, to 0.697 between TN1086 line and TN1087 line. For ISJ, the values ranged from 0.052 between TN1084 line and TN2462 line, to 0.312 between TN2457 line and KC210031 line, and for RAPD +ISJ the values ranged from 0.147 between TN2420 line and TN2026 line, to 0.471 between TN1087 line and TN1086 line. In the ISJ markers the UPGMA cluster diagram have showed 3 major clusters: one cluster included the TN2026 line, the second cluster were contained TN2128, TN2022, TN2461, TN2464, TN1885, TN2463 and the third cluster were contained rest of lentil lines. In RAPD and combined of RAPD and ISJ markers, the UPGMA cluster diagram have showed 2 major clusters. Cistan local cultivar had higher genetic distance than TN2026 line in each three methods of grouping. Therefore in order to favourable genes transfer from TN2026 line to Cistan local cultivar should be considerable genetic distance.
